How To Watch the Super Bowl 2024

Get your game plan ready for the biggest matchup of the year. We’ve laid out all your best options for watching Super Bowl LVIII.

Super Bowl LVIII kicks off on CBS, Paramount+, and Nickelodeon at 6:30 p.m. Eastern on Sunday, February 11, 2024. The game will take place at Allegiant Stadium in Paradise, Nevada—home of the Las Vegas Raiders.

Capping off the 2023 NFL season, Super Bowl LVIII promises an exciting matchup between the AFC and NFC champions. The best way to tune in is with an over-the-air (OTA) antenna as long as you live within range of a CBS affiliate station. But you can also catch the championship game with a Paramount+ Premium subscription or any cable, satellite, or live TV streaming service that offers CBS or Nickelodeon.

What channel is the Super Bowl on in 2024?

You can watch the 2024 Super Bowl game on CBS, Paramount+, and Nickelodeon at 6:30 p.m. Eastern on Sunday, February 11. Apart from Paramount+, you can also stream Super Bowl LVIII on NFL+ using a mobile phone or tablet.

For those who prefer watching American football en Español, Univision will air Spanish-language coverage of Super Bowl LVIII. It will be Univision’s first time televising the NFL championship game—partnering with CBS Sports for the broadcast.

Best TV plans for watching the Super Bowl

You don’t need a full-blown cable or satellite subscription to watch Super Bowl LVIII. A simple digital antenna can pick up the Big Game if you live near a CBS broadcast network. For just a one-time purchase—usually between $20 and $60—a digital antenna will also score you other primetime NFL games in the build-up to the Super Bowl. Certain antennas like the Mohu Leaf 50 ($47.99 on Amazon) are even 4K-capable—something not all TV providers can offer.

Pro tip: Enter your zip code into the Federal Communications Commission’s (FCC) Reception Map Tool to verify which antenna channels are available in your area.

Perhaps you don’t live within range of a CBS station but have reliable internet access. If that’s the case, a Paramount+ Premium subscription will have you covered for $9.99 a month. The streaming service comes with live access to your local CBS station alongside tons of on-demand shows and movies.

How to watch the Super Bowl on mobile

The great thing about the Super Bowl is that you can watch it anywhere. If mobile viewing is your jam, you can stream the game on Paramount+ or any live TV streaming service that carries CBS—including fuboTV, Hulu + Live TV, and YouTube TV. Cable and satellite TV subscribers can also stream the matchup on the CBS Sports and CBS TV apps.

NFL+ is another reliable way to watch the Super Bowl on your phone or tablet. With plans starting at $6.99 a month, it’s also the cheapest way to stream the Big Game.

Super Bowl halftime show

This season, Usher will perform during the Super Bowl halftime show. The multi-platinum singer-songwriter-dancer will have roughly 12 minutes to light up Allegiant Stadium. But of course, there’s no doubt the King of R&B will deliver.

The performance marks the second year Apple Music will act as the halftime show’s main sponsor. Previously, Pepsi held primary sponsorship duties for ten years. But the beverage company bowed out to focus on other NFL opportunities, like the NFL Draft.

How to watch the Super Bowl FAQ

Can I stream the Super Bowl for free?

Yes, you can stream the Super Bowl for free on CBS by signing up for a free trial of YouTube TV. Another inexpensive way to watch the game is with a digital antenna. While the antenna isn’t free, you’ll get access to CBS without paying a monthly subscription.

Can I watch the Super Bowl without cable?

Yes, you can watch the Super Bowl without cable or satellite TV service. Any paid live TV streaming service that carries CBS in its channel lineup will do, like Y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, and DIRECTV STREAM. You can also stream the game live on mobile devices with NFL+, starting at $6.99 a month.

Will the Super Bowl be on Amazon Prime Video?

Yes, you can stream the 2024 Super Bowl on Amazon Prime Video if you subscribe to Paramount+ through Prime Video Channels. Prime Video is also home to Thursday Night Football NFL games during the regular season.

Will the Super Bowl be on Hulu?

Yes, you can stream Super Bowl LVIII on Hulu + Live TV by tuning in to CBS on gameday.

Is the Super Bowl on NFL Sunday Ticket?

No, nationally televised NFL games like the Super Bowl, the Pro Bowl Games, and the NFL Playoffs don’t air on NFL Sunday Ticket.

Who is singing the national anthem at Super Bowl 2024?

We don’t know who’ll perform the national anthem at Super Bowl LVIII. Last season, Chris Stapleton sang and Troy Kotsur signed “The Star-Spangled Banner” at Super Bowl LVII. Also, before kickoff, R&B legend Babyface sang “America the Beautiful,” while Abbott Elementary actress Sheryl Lee Ralph performed “Lift Every Voice and Sing.”
